[arch-commits] Commit in python-raven/trunk (PKGBUILD)
Felix Yan
felixonmars at archlinux.org
Thu Nov 16 23:56:46 UTC 2017
Date: Thursday, November 16, 2017 @ 23:56:46
Author: felixonmars
Revision: 267053
upgpkg: python-raven 6.3.0-1
Modified:
python-raven/trunk/PKGBUILD
----------+
PKGBUILD | 27 +++++++++++++++------------
1 file changed, 15 insertions(+), 12 deletions(-)
Modified: PKGBUILD
===================================================================
--- PKGBUILD 2017-11-16 23:49:25 UTC (rev 267052)
+++ PKGBUILD 2017-11-16 23:56:46 UTC (rev 267053)
@@ -4,13 +4,13 @@
pkgbase=python-raven
pkgname=(python-raven python2-raven)
-pkgver=6.1.0
+pkgver=6.3.0
pkgrel=1
pkgdesc="Python client for Sentry"
arch=('any')
url="http://pypi.python.org/pypi/raven"
license=('BSD')
-makedepends=('python-setuptools' 'python2-setuptools' 'python2-contextlib2' 'git')
+makedepends=('python-setuptools' 'python2-setuptools' 'python2-contextlib2')
checkdepends=('python-pytest-cov' 'python2-pytest-cov' 'python-bottle' 'python2-bottle'
'python-celery' 'python2-celery' 'python-django' 'python2-django'
'python-pycodestyle' 'python2-pycodestyle' 'python-mock' 'python2-mock' 'python-nose'
@@ -21,19 +21,22 @@
'python-flask' 'python2-flask' 'python-blinker' 'python2-blinker' 'python-logbook'
'python2-logbook' 'python-pytest-django' 'python2-pytest-django' 'python2-webpy'
'python-flask-login' 'python2-flask-login' 'python-pytest-timeout'
- 'python2-pytest-timeout')
-source=("git+https://github.com/getsentry/raven-python.git#tag=$pkgver")
-sha512sums=('SKIP')
+ 'python2-pytest-timeout' 'python-zconfig' 'python2-zconfig')
+source=("$pkgbase-$pkgver.tar.gz::https://github.com/getsentry/raven-python/archive/$pkgver.tar.gz")
+sha512sums=('e8708206d3840ca087b9428d5243306be83c4a8d59a9f32d53dc7e1a931c647410a37a2aa5bd0853e30e41137f0a318f5c509a5fd3b8c8815ccb126d65a04458')
prepare() {
- cp -a raven-python{,-py2}
+ # Remove in next version
+ sed -i '/recursive-include/a recursive-include raven/contrib/zconfig *.xml' raven-python-$pkgver/MANIFEST.in
+
+ cp -a raven-python-$pkgver{,-py2}
}
build() {
- cd "$srcdir"/raven-python
+ cd "$srcdir"/raven-python-$pkgver
python setup.py build
- cd "$srcdir"/raven-python-py2
+ cd "$srcdir"/raven-python-$pkgver-py2
python2 setup.py build
}
@@ -40,12 +43,12 @@
check() {
# Hack distribution check by installing it
- cd "$srcdir"/raven-python
+ cd "$srcdir"/raven-python-$pkgver
python setup.py install --root="$PWD/tmp_install" --optimize=1
PYTHONPATH="$PWD/tmp_install/usr/lib/python3.6/site-packages:$PYTHONPATH" \
py.test tests
- cd "$srcdir"/raven-python
+ cd "$srcdir"/raven-python-$pkgver
python2 setup.py install --root="$PWD/tmp_install" --optimize=1
PYTHONPATH="$PWD/tmp_install/usr/lib/python2.7/site-packages:$PYTHONPATH" \
py.test2 tests
@@ -55,7 +58,7 @@
depends=('python')
optdepends=('python-setuptools: for "raven" script')
- cd "$srcdir"/raven-python
+ cd "$srcdir"/raven-python-$pkgver
python setup.py install --root="$pkgdir" --optimize=1
install -Dm664 LICENSE "$pkgdir"/usr/share/licenses/$pkgname/LICENSE
}
@@ -64,7 +67,7 @@
depends=('python2-contextlib2')
optdepends=('python2-setuptools: for "raven2" script')
- cd "$srcdir"/raven-python-py2
+ cd "$srcdir"/raven-python-$pkgver-py2
python2 setup.py install --root="$pkgdir" --optimize=1
mv "$pkgdir"/usr/bin/raven{,2}
More information about the arch-commits
mailing list